MSS is a world-class research and development engineering firm specializing in

safety-critical systems and software, striving to build and maintain long-term business alliances based on the principles of expert and cost-effective engineering. Technical excellence is achieved through the use of highly experienced engineers able to immediately contribute to new projects. Strong customer focus enables this lean and responsive organization to tailor its services to customer's needs, ensuring all technical and program requirements are met. In order to best support customer requirements, MSS will dedicate resources to encompass expertise in Project Management, Systems Engineering, Safety Engineering and Software Engineering, as required.

Project Management

Our Project Managers and Engineering Team Leaders are highly experienced engineers with 10 to 20 years of experience with various aerospace and defense companies. Project Managers ensure the MSS teams are focused on all engineering deliverables and are keenly aware of schedule and cost. Regular program status updates are provided to our customers to ensure compliance with program costs and milestones.
